The Prime Minister held his first calls with major business groups to present a new government offer aimed at strengthening collaboration with the private sector. The initiative focuses on providing greater certainty, faster decision-making, and a stronger business voice in policy shaping to drive growth across the UK. Key measures include 20% relief for pubs, clubs, and music venues to reduce costs for town centre businesses. The PM emphasized tackling youth unemployment by encouraging employers to work with the government to support young people into work. The offer also includes plans to streamline decision-making, devolve power to local communities, and ensure fair standards in essential services. The government aims to create a more agile state while maintaining active oversight of markets and regulators to protect workers’ interests.
